Вниз  AKAI on JavaME
- 14.05.2013 / 22:40
vl@volk
  Пользователь

vl@volk 
Сейчас: Offline
Помните AKAI которое написал limil на MobileBASIC. Так как его прога отказалась работать на моих телефонах нокиа я решил ее воплотить на JavaME. Это не первая версия, в этой версии более все оптимизировано работает на моих нокиах.

Управление:
- левый и правый софткеи, центр джойстика и ноль - выход;
- кнопки от 1 до 9 - еффекты;
- *, # - переключение между фоновыми мелодиями.
Так же осуществленна поддержка сенсорного экрана. Управление аналогично кнопочному.

Приношу благодарность пользователям:
- limil'у за замечательную идею;
- Magatino за исходник работы с MMAPI.

Спешу порадовать helltar'а и всех кто кодит на MIDletPasсal. Класс AKAISound вы можете использовать как библиотеку для работы с музыкой. Классы я не обфусцировал так, как проект с открытыми исходными кодами.

Ну и самое главное название проги AKAI Anna.
Anna - это дискриптор версии 2.0
ОБНОВЛЕНИЕ! Стабильная версия для мобильных Nokia(c) s40 6-th edition( исходники также обновлены ).
Проект закрыт.

:ps: возможно на слабых мобилах фоновая мелодия будет воспроизводится не сразу, так как тратится время на загрузку мелодий.
__________________
 знает толк

Изменено vl@volk (1.06 / 22:03) (всего 6 раз)


Прикрепленные файлы:
AKAI_Anna_2.3.jar (316.21 кб.) Скачано 313 раз
AKAI_Anna_2.3_s(…).zip (3.42 кб.) Скачано 132 раза
- 14.05.2013 / 22:43
ВитаминКО
  Супермодератор

ВитаминКО 
Сейчас: Offline
vl@volk, вот за класс +
__________________
 わからない!!
- 14.05.2013 / 22:49
Helltar
  Пользователь

Helltar 
Сейчас: Offline
Класс AKAISound вы можете использовать как библиотеку для работы с музыкойОн отличается чем-то? от:
- Lib_mmapi
- lib_player

Открыть спойлер

- 14.05.2013 / 22:53
Its_Your_Soul
  Пользователь

Its_Your_Soul 
Сейчас: Offline
AKAI for JavaME = AKAI для JavaMe
0.о
- 14.05.2013 / 22:59
vl@volk
  Пользователь

vl@volk 
Сейчас: Offline
Helltar, довольно прост. можно сразу массив мелодий еередать и потом по индексу вызывать. в сорцах все понятно.
сейчас файл загружу. опера глючит
__________________
 знает толк
- 14.05.2013 / 23:05
vl@volk
  Пользователь

vl@volk 
Сейчас: Offline
ну и на нокиа корректно работает
__________________
 знает толк
- 14.05.2013 / 23:36
Helltar
  Пользователь

Helltar 
Сейчас: Offline
Helltar, довольно прост. можно сразу массив мелодий еередать и потом по индексу вызывать. в сорцах все понятно.Я спрашиваю, чем она круче тех что выше, какие преимущества?
- 15.05.2013 / 00:04
vl@volk
  Пользователь

vl@volk 
Сейчас: Offline
да ничем особо не выделяется. конструктор принимает массив файлов и тип ( есть вариант массив типов, если разные мелодии ). потом тебе надо включить первую(или седьмую) мелодию и проиграть один раз. ты вызываешь сначала метод playSounds( 1, false) и за ним сразу зовешь stopSound(1), когда мелодия закончится плеер автоматически остановится и освободит занятые им ресурсу. есть быстрый стоп с очисткой momentalStopSound( 1 ) - он моментально вырубает мелодию. например ты написал плеер и когда переключаешь на другую мелодию то вызываешь этот метод и он сразу остановит проигрывание музыки.
так же можно вызвать метод playSounds(1, true) и тогда мелодия проиграет 10 раз подряд. можно переписать чтоб можно было указать сколько раз воспроизводить подряд
__________________
 знает толк
- 15.05.2013 / 00:29
vl@volk
  Пользователь

vl@volk 
Сейчас: Offline
кто тестил? как работает? и воспроизводится ли у вас сингл на кнопке 9?
__________________
 знает толк
- 15.05.2013 / 00:38
Its_Your_Soul
  Пользователь

Its_Your_Soul 
Сейчас: Offline
vl@volk, на к550 летает . Только там глюки какие то о_о версия еще сырая.
9 не работет
Наверх  Всего сообщений: 73
Фильтровать сообщения
Поиск по теме
Файлы топика (5)